One of the most interesting proprietary aspects of the exchange is its KuCoin Shares (KCS) ERC-20 token. The exchange incentivizes the use of these tokens by giving users a great discount on platform fees for making trades in KuCoin Shares instead of, say, BTC or ETH.

As far as verification levels go, Binance is straightforward. For new users who haven’t passed the first level, you’ll be subjected to a 2 bitcoin daily withdrawal limit. Pretty fair. However, if you achieve level 2 verification, then you’ll be allowed to withdrawal as many as 100 bitcoins each and every day. It’s worth it to verify if you’re doing massive trades, then.
